Mesothelioma and Asbestos Lawyer

A mesothelioma lawyer and asbestos lawyer can assist victims and their families collect compensation from sources like trust funds, VA benefits and personal injury lawsuits. They can also identify possible exposure sources for those who aren't sure where they were exposed to asbestos.

A mesothelioma attorney should have expertise with asbestos firms in the national market and a track record of obtaining significant settlements. They should offer a free assessment of your case.

The lawsuits for wrongful death are an important aspect of mesothelioma litigation. These cases are filed on behalf of family members who have lost a loved one due to asbestos exposure. Families may be entitled compensation for funeral expenses, loss of companionship and other damages.

Based on the state, victims and their families could be eligible for compensation from asbestos trust funds. These trusts are created in the event of bankruptcy of companies that once produced or employed asbestos. They are meant to protect assets that could be used to pay asbestos-related legal costs. The compensation from these trusts will significantly increase the amount of mesothelioma settlements.
